喷出

这是一个万博manbetx贴吧感恩节周传统:抓住OS X Finder。

今天的示例涉及Panther Finder中非常具体的点击实例(通过点击当背景中的窗口接受鼠标点击而不将窗口首先放在前面时会发生什么查看以前的火球这里这里有关点击的更多信息。)

Finder新侧边栏的顶部显示了所有可用的卷(好吧,不是真的所有,因为它不会显示通过现在排序的功能顶级“网络”dingus安装的网络卷,但这是另一个故事。)可以卸载的卷旁边有一个弹出按钮:

新Finder侧栏中的卷列表。

如果将鼠标光标悬停在弹出按钮上,它会亮起:

Mouse cursor hovering over eject button.

如果您要获得已安装卷的列表,则弹出按钮是个好主意At least in terms of being obvious and natural, it’s certainly an improvement over the Mac’s ancient drag-the-volume-icon-to-the-Trash gesture, which is infamously weird — if you drag files and folders to the Trash to delete them, it seems natural to drag a volume to the Trash to抹去它这肯定是大多数新Mac用户所假设的。

-我将FireWire磁盘图标拖到废纸篓中以将其弹出?

- 我知道这听起来很奇怪,但是是的。

-真?

- 对。

-它不会擦除磁盘?

- 不。

与Mac OS 9相比,Mac OS X上的垃圾操作手势不那么可怕,因为一旦你启动了这样的拖动,Dock中的垃圾桶图标就会变成一个弹出按钮但即使这有点尴尬,因为直到您开始拖动磁盘图标后才会出现弹出图标。

所以,到目前为止,这么好原则上,侧边栏的弹出按钮是卷列表的一个好主意除了使它显而易见怎么样要弹出/卸载卷,它还可以明显地卸载哪些卷例如,您无法卸载启动盘,因此它没有弹出按钮。

蓝色选择颜色与漂亮的渐变混合,不是基于我的首选颜色It’s hard-coded, and “standard” only in the sense that it matches the gradient blue selection style in iTunes’s and iCal’s sidebars(另一方面,iPhoto使用常规选择颜色作为其侧边栏中的项目,根据iLife套件的不正常的人机界面标准,可以说是错误。)同样,弹出按钮看起来不像标准按钮但是在罗马时,就像罗马人一样。

当Finder窗口在后台时,弹出按钮的情况变得奇怪如果Finder仍然是活动应用程序,当您将鼠标悬停在背景窗口中的弹出按钮上时,按钮的翻转效果仍会亮起:

当Finder处于活动状态时,鼠标光标悬停在背景窗口中的弹出按钮上。

但是,如果此时单击鼠标,它实际上并未卸载卷 - 它只会使窗口向前移动。

但是,如果Finder本身不是活动应用程序,则当鼠标悬停在它们上时,弹出按钮不再亮起:

鼠标光标悬停在背景窗口中的弹出按钮上,而Finder也在后台。

但是,如果您在此时单击,则不仅会激活该Finder窗口,但磁盘已卸载

In other words, when the Finder is the active app, the eject buttons in background windows look like they support click-through (because they light up when you mouse over them), but they don’t; when the Finder is not the active app, the eject buttons look like they支持点击(因为它们不亮),但它们确实如此。

更新:它最终窗口也必须在图标视图中才能发生这种情况感谢几位帮助缩小范围的读者。

这太奇怪了,它必须是一个bug首先,尽管事实上我有一个关于OS X Finder的人工界面投诉的书籍长度列表,但我很少抱怨它处理点击的方式实际上,Finder是经过深思熟虑的点击行为的典范。

最不合适的点击控制是最危险的控制虽然您不会因意外触发弹出按钮而丢失数据,但您可以通过重新安装音量来减少相当多的时间(并且您不能使用撤消来重新安装音量。)点击查看在Finder侧栏中的任何其他位置都不起作用,因此无意中为弹出按钮进行了有意义的启用此外,弹出按钮点击只要如果已在侧栏中选择了有问题的卷,并且仅当窗口处于图标视图中时才有效。

仔细点击。

进一步阅读

Eric Blair描述了Panther Finder中的另一个点击故障: Command-clicking in the toolbar allows you to rearrange the buttons while the window is in the background, which (a) you probably don’t want to do; and (b) gets in the way of your ability to Command-drag a background window to move it without bringing it forward.

以前: 黑豹的锡拉库扎
下一个: 黑豹收养率